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1808884 59925 4172 643971
364 001702341 134
364 001702341 134
53896 33738 8770984 338515
All about undefined
Interested in learning more?
364 001702341 134
53896 33738 8770984 338515
See more
76705059480 34140819084 8608450
332989458 58 12156 33426273
See more
2566761 05
8205910 17 68608 443137494
See more